How can companies effectively balance the use of data analytics and machine learning in their onboarding processes to ensure personalized customer experiences while maintaining data privacy and security?
Companies can effectively balance the use of data analytics and machine learning in their onboarding processes by implementing robust data privacy and security measures, such as encryption and access controls. They can also utilize anonymized or aggregated data to personalize customer experiences without compromising individual privacy. Additionally, companies should regularly update their data privacy policies and obtain explicit consent from customers before collecting and analyzing their data. By prioritizing both personalized customer experiences and data privacy, companies can build trust with their customers and differentiate themselves in the market.
